Comic Book Made In Philadelphia Hits Shelves

By Justin Udo

PHILADELPHIA (CBS) -- There's a new comic book out on shelves that's made and produced right here in Philadelphia.

Blak Pulp is an independent comic book company that recently launched their first anthology.

It contains stories from various creators.

"Everything we do is a part of where we're from. It's gritty, it's real, it's visceral, but it's all about love and connecting people."

Brandon Williams is one of the owners of Blak Pulp. He says they plan on releasing new issues every other month and they'll be available at Amalgam Comics & Coffeehouse in Kensington.

"We have openings in Blak Pulp for any artist who would like to be a part of it. All you have to do is be able to tell a good story. If you can tell a story and draw it out, we're accepting people to join Blak Pulp."
